WordPress Settings
The settings available are for you to set defaults according to your preferences. WordPress Settings by default are: General, Writing, Reading, Discussion, Media, Permalinks settings in your WordPress Dashboard. Note: if you install certain WordPress Plugins, then, they may also add new settings options for those plugins. WordPress Dashboard
WordPress dashboard is the first screen that you will see once you login to your WordPress built website. You can think of your WordPress Dashboard as a control panel to quickly navigate through your website’s settings.
